| "Here We Live Over the
Last Fifty Years", Peru and Miami County, 1885-1935 published
by Omer Holman, of the "Peru Evening News" from Jan. 1, 1885 to Jan. 6,
1906, & then the Peru Republican. Newspaper excerpts of social
news, obituaries, marriages, etc. There is no index, so at least an
approximate date would be helpful. There are some pictures
(see list) which Patricia might be willing to scan and email. |
